An airplane consists of the airframe, power plant, instruments, furnishings and accessories.

There are three broad type of planes which were developed are land, water, or both. In this case this is how planes are separated. Landing planes have wheels, skids, endless tracks, and skis. Seaplanes have airtight boats for landing. An amphibious plane can take off and land on water or land.


The power plant of a plane has a carburetor and fuel pump, fuel, oil tanks, and lines. The instruments are devices that helps the pilot fly, navigating, engine performance, and indicating operating equipment. The furnishings can be found on the inside of the plane like seats, safety belts, cupboards, and etc. The accessories are things like lighting systems or engine accessories.
